In this on the water bass fishing video, learn how to fish a magnum shaky head worm. Pete Gluszek is not known for wanting to throw small/slow finesse techniques, and for good reason, covering water with bigger profile baits often catches bigger fish. Particularly in a 5 biggest bass tournament, upgrading your bass size is more important than catching numbers. We all know that the shaky head is a great finesse technique and it excels at catching numbers of bass. Pete is here to show you some slight modifications that will keep you catching lots of fish, but often triggering strikes from bigger bass.
